你查询的IP:[59.155.189.187]  地理位置:中国–上海–上海电信

最新查询125.32.154.210 123.112.60.3 123.137.109.96 119.144.70.94 119.153.46.218 118.180.245.101 121.4.104.212 118.124.255.36 121.76.90.25 59.155.189.187 202.60.112.217 202.131.16.136 202.38.150.69 116.90.184.210 211.96.186.10 122.102.64.91 221.136.78.105 58.30.182.23 203.192.13.230 121.32.77.6 119.18.192.253 210.52.229.254 118.230.252.224 119.40.64.204 124.224.30.181 124.112.181.107 202.143.16.240 119.88.190.210 118.184.245.132 202.173.224.60 119.10.26.122